Today, entertainment icon and rapper Snoop Dogg announces High School Reunion Tour with Wiz Khalifa, Too $hort, Warren G, and Berner featuring special guest DJ Drama. Produced by Live Nation, the massive 33-city tour kicks off on Friday July 7 at Rogers Arena in Vancouver making stops across the U.S. in Brooklyn, Atlanta, Houston and more before wrapping up in Irvine at FivePoint Amphitheatre on Saturday August 27.

About Wiz Khalifa:
Multi-platinum selling, GRAMMY and Golden Globe nominated recording artist Wiz Khalifa burst onto the scene with the release of his first major label debut album, ROLLING PAPERS in 2011. ROLLING PAPERS spawned the hugely successful hits “Black and Yellow,” “Roll Up,” and “No Sleep” and gave Wiz the platform to win the award for “Best New Artist” at the 2011 BET Awards and “Top New Artist” at the 2012 Billboard Music Awards. “Black and Yellow” also earned him his first two GRAMMY nods for “Best Rap Performance” and “Best Rap Song”. As a follow up to ROLLING PAPERS, Wiz Released O.N.I.F.C. in 2012. This album featured tracks “Work Hard, Play Hard” and “Remember You” featuring The Weeknd. His third studio album released in 2014, BLACC HOLLYWOOD, debuted at #1 on Billboard’s Top 200 album chart and included the hit single “We DemBoyz.” Soon after, Wiz’s track, “See You Again,” off the FURIOUS 7 soundtrack, catapulted to the top of the charts across 95 countries and earned him a Golden Globes nomination for “Best Original Song”. In February 2018, Wiz partnered with Sovereign Brands to create McQueen and the Violet Fog, an Award winning gin and rated by the NY Times as the “Best Gin”.. In July 2022, Wiz released his full-length solo album MULTIVERSE, to rave reviews, as well as MULTIVERSE (DELUXE) which included three additional tracks, “We Can Get More”, “Funkin”, and “Lost”. This spring, Wiz will star as George Clinton in the upcoming motion picture, Spinning Gold, to be released in theaters on March 31, 2023.
About Too $hort:
Todd “Too $hort” Shaw is a multiplatinum hip-hop artist, songwriter and entrepreneur that hails from Oakland, California. Over the course of his illustrious career as an artist, $hort has cemented his legacy as a hip-hop heavyweight and pioneer of West Coast rap, having amassed six platinum albums and four gold certifications with smash songs like “Blow the Whistle,” “Shake That Monkey,” “The Ghetto,” “Gettin It” and more. With the release of his 22 nd solo studio album ( Ain’t Gone Do It) in December 2020, $hort earned the unique distinction of becoming the only active hip-hop artist to have released an album in five different decades, punctuating an already vast catalog that included acclaimed albums such as Life Is… Too Short, Short Dog’s in the House, Shorty the Pimp, Get In Where You Fit In, Cocktails, Gettin’ It (Album Number Ten), etc. He is also the only artist to have collaborated with Tupac, The Notorious B.I.G. and JAY-Z.
About Warren G:
The cultural influence of groundbreaking American rapper, record producer, media personality, philanthropist, and entrepreneur WARREN G (born Warren Griffin III) remains as urgent today as his 1994, multi-platinum-selling smash “Regulate.” Recorded with childhood friend and iconic superstar Nate Dogg, the track would define the rap genre and a generation. For three decades, Griffin has sold eight to ten million records worldwide. Today, he is crafting a new narrative, by extending his reach into the culinary arts, inspired by his family history.
As a solo artist, Griffin signed to Def Jam Records, collaborating with such artists as MC Breed and 2Pac. His early career breakthrough was achieved in 1992 when his vocal collaboration with Mista Grimm on the track “Indo Smoke,” which appeared on the Poetic Justice soundtrack. His creative momentum continued with significant contributions to Dr. Dre’s iconic 1992 debut album, The Chronic, including sampling for “Nuthin’ but a G-Thang,” a track that would be distinguished by the Rock and Roll Hall of Fame as one of the “500 Songs That Shaped Rock and Roll.” In 2019, Griffin found inspiration from his family history, this time in the culinary arts, by launching Sniffin Griffins BBQ sauces and rubs. About Berner:
Berner, born Gilbert Anthony Milam, Jr. (10/27/1983) is a Billboard charting rapper, cannabis trailblazer, documentary filmmaker, cultural ambassador, and business mogul. Berner is Co-Founder and CEO of Cookies , the most globally recognized cannabis brand in the world. Cookies is headquartered in San Francisco and offers a collection of over 70 proprietary cannabis cultivars, more than 2,000 products, with 58 retail locations across 6 countries. Cookies was named one of America’s Hottest Brands of 2021 by AdAge; the first cannabis brand to ever receive this accolade. In addition to Cookies, Berner has released 47 albums to date as an independent artist, and has founded/co-founded the following businesses, establishing himself as one of the most important influencers in the industry; 1212 Ventures, Lemonnade, Cookies SF, Weedmaps, Vibes, Santa Cruz Shredders, Hemp2o Water, Vibes, Bern One Entertainment Music Label and Social Club.
About DJ Drama:
Tyree Simmons, better known to the world as DJ Drama, is one of the most iconic voices in the history of hip hop. With a career spanning nearly 2 decades, the multi-platinum selling artist and DJ single handedly helped forever change the hip hop landscape with his legendary Gangsta Grillz brand, which has over 200 classic mixtapes to date with a plethora of hip hop heavyweights including Lil Wayne, T.I., Fabolous, Jeezy, Meek Mill and Chris Brown to name a few.
As one third of Generation Now, DJ Drama added record executive to his resume. Along with his partners, Don Cannon and Lake Show, Drama is responsible for discovering and developing global superstars Lil Uzi Vert and Jack Harlow, to name a few. In 2021, the Philadelphia-bred, Atlanta based superstar won his first GRAMMY for his work on Tyler The Creator’s CALL ME IF YOU GET LOST, which helped give the Gangsta Grillz brand a new life, bridging the gap between hip hop fans old and new. Drama is now set to once again show the world why he is one of the greatest of all time with his 2023 album, I’M REALLY LIKE THAT.

Snoop Dogg, Wiz Khalifa, Too $hort, Warren G & Berner Announce ‘High School Reunion’ Tour
Snoop Dogg and Wiz Khalifa are joining forces for a star-studded North American trek this summer branded as the High School Reunion Tour.
The Mac & Devin Go to High School collaborators will be joined by Too $hort, Warren G, Berner, DJ Drama and more on the 33-city tour which will kick off North of the border in Vancouver on July 7.
Citi pre-sale tickets are available on Tuesday (March 7), while general admission tickets go on sale on Ticketmaster on March 10 at 9 a.m. local time.
Look for the tour to make stops in Utha, Denver, St. Louis, Brooklyn, Virginia Beach, Atlanta, Tampa Bay, New Orleans, Houston, Dallas, Sacramento, Phoenix and wrap up with a show in Irvine, California on August 27.
News of the tour comes after Wiz and Snoop teased what some thought was a sequel to 2012’s Mac & Devin Go To High School . However, it looks like it might have been teasing their newly announced tour.
“High school reunion comin summer 23 @wizkhalifa,” Snoop wrote in his post accompanied by a photo of him and Wiz in the studio together.
In his own Instagram post of the photo, the Pittsburgh native declared him and Snoop “the new Cheech and Chong” while using the hashtag “#highschoolreuinion.”
Last week, the pair linked up for lonely stoner anthem “Don’t Text Don’t Call.”
Prior to the High School Reunion Tour, Wiz will hit hit the road for a sprint through the Midwest as part of his seven-city The Good Trip Tour alongside Joey Bada$$, Berner, Smoke DZA and Chevy Woods.
That trek kicks off on April 15 in Kalamazoo, Michigan and includes stops in Milwaukee, Minneapolis, Lincoln and finishes up at Colorado’s famous Red Rocks Amphitheater on April 22.

Wiz Khalifa, Snoop Dogg announce "High School Reunion Tour"
Wiz Khalifa and Snoop Dogg are hitting the road on the “High School Reunion Tour,” but they won’t be alone this summer. As the Pittsburgh native took to social media to announce the news, he also mentioned that rappers Too Short, Warren G, Berner, and special guest DJ Drama will join them. The tour will kick off on July 7 in Vancouver, British Columbia and end on Aug. 27 in Irvine, California. Tickets for the upcoming dates will go on sale on March 10 at 9 a.m. local time. Khalifa also informed fans to text “TG” to 412-226-4201 if they want early presale access.
I’m hittin the road on the High School Reunion Tour with @SnoopDogg , @TooShort , @regulator , @Berner415 , and Special Guest @DJDrama ! Tickets on sale March 10th at 9am Local. Can’t wait to see y’all. 💨 #HighSchoolReunionTour https://t.co/fAzezUI19F pic.twitter.com/IdVqv7LAlF — Wiz Khalifa (@wizkhalifa) March 6, 2023
On March 2, Khalifa shared online that he, Berner, Joey Bada$$, Smoke DZA, and Chevy Woods were embarking on “ The Good Trip Tour ,” which is only a week long, in April. A day before that announcement, the “Black and Yellow” artist and Snoop Dogg collaborated to release the Ty Dolla $ign-produced track “Don’t Text Don’t Call.” They initially dropped the song in 2022 on the NFT project An 8th.
That same year, Snoop Dogg announced that he acquired his former label, Death Row Records , days before his halftime performance at Super Bowl LVI . “I am thrilled and appreciative of the opportunity to acquire the iconic and culturally significant Death Row Records brand, which has immense untapped future value,” he said in a statement. “It feels good to have ownership of the label I was part of at the beginning of my career and as one of the founding members . This is an extremely meaningful moment for me.”
However, Khalifa and Snoop Dogg’s friendship goes back further than last year. On July 3, 2012, the duo starred alongside each other in the film Mac & Devin Go to High School . In it, Khalifa and Snoop Dogg portrayed two high school students, one who was an overachiever having issues writing his valedictorian speech, and the other a senior in his 15th year of school.

Korolyov or Korolev is an industrial city in Moscow Oblast, Russia, well known as the cradle of Soviet and Russian space exploration. As of the 2010 Census, its population was 183,402, the largest as a science city. As of 2018, the population was more than 222,000 people. It was known as Kaliningrad from 1938 to 1996 and served as the leading Soviet center for production of anti-tank and air-defense guns. In 1946, in the aftermath of World War II, the artillery plant was reconstructed for production of rockets, launch vehicles, and spacecraft, under the guidance of Russian scientist and academician Sergei Korolev, who envisioned, consolidated and guided the activities of many people in the Soviet space-exploration program. The plant later became known as the RKK Energia; when the Vostok space vehicle was being developed, this research center was designated as NII-88 or POB 989.
